But, I just finished my new favorite, albeit non-tradidional, event. I posted about it on the weekly thread but figured I'd throw it in here too.
It was a marathon relay all run inside the Cleveland Zoo. It was 22 laps of 1.19 miles. You could run it solo, or with teams of 2, 3, or 4. I did it on a 4 person co-ed team (2 guys and 2 girls).
What made it really different was that you didn't do your whole leg and pass the baton like most relays, you did one lap, then the second runner did one lap, then the third, then the fourth, and back to the first. It was really different, more like a track workout meets a marathon relay but it was a lot of fun.
